At its core, a virtual laboratoriya acts as an information system that provides tools, materials, and techniques on a computer screen or browser. These platforms simulate real physical, chemical, or biological processes. Virtual labs provide a secure environment for dangerous

Students can access these tools anytime and anywhere, breaking the constraints of physical laboratory hours.

Users, typically students, interact with virtual apparatuses, such as oscilloscopes, microscopes, or test tubes, in a 3D or 2D environment. materials) High initial

Unlike physical labs, where supplies are finite, virtual labs allow experiments to be conducted endlessly until mastery is achieved.

Virtual tools, such as the Electronic Workbench for electronics training, allow students to observe the inner workings of circuits.
